To protect your wooden urban outdoor furniture from water rings and heat stains left by drinks, proactive and consistent care is essential. The primary defense is to always use coasters and placemats. These create a physical barrier that catches condensation and insulates against hot mug bottoms. For added protection, apply a high-quality sealant or finish designed for exterior wood, such as a polyurethane, spar urethane, or marine varnish. Reapply this finish as recommended, typically every one to two years, to maintain its protective layer. If a stain does occur, act quickly. Blot up spills immediately. For white water rings, lightly sand the area and re-oil or re-seal. For darker heat stains, a paste of baking soda and water or a specialized wood cleaner may help. Regular cleaning with a mild soap solution and soft cloth, followed by complete drying, will also preserve the wood's integrity. Finally, consider using fitted furniture covers during harsh weather or long periods of non-use to provide an extra shield against all elements, including moisture.
